AHA’s Advancing Health podcast booth captures rural conference insights 
For the second consecutive year, speakers and attendees at the 2024 Rural Health Care Leadership Conference recorded Advancing Health podcasts live on site. The recordings cover a range of topics addressed during the event, including behavioral health and prenatal care, workforce challenges, cybersecurity, virtual training, governance, and the rural emergency hospital model.

The podcast recordings feature AHA leaders such as Michelle Hood, executive vice president and chief operating officer; John Riggi, national advisor for cybersecurity and risk; and John Supplitt, senior director for field engagement and rural health services, among others, as well as participants from AHA member hospitals.
